Company: Bailey Davol Studio Build
Location: Jamaica Plain, MA
Key Responsibilities- Design Selections:
- Develop cohesive interior finish palettes aligned with project scope, budget, and schedule.
- Source and specify all interior selections (cabinetry, countertops, tile, plumbing, lighting, hardware, flooring, appliances, paint, etc.).
- Present selections to clients and guide decision-making with clarity and confidence.
- Procurement & Purchasing:
- Place and manage orders for all design-related materials and products.
- Facilitate invoicing of clients for all selections.
- Track lead times, deliveries, backorders, and changes.
- Coordinate with vendors, showrooms, and trade partners.
- Manage returns, exchanges, damages, and warranty issues.
- Maintain accurate selection logs and procurement documentation.
- Project Coordination:
- Collaborate closely with estimators, project managers, and lead carpenters.
- Support pricing, value engineering, and constructability reviews.
- Communicate selection-related impacts to schedule and budget.
- Participate in site visits to confirm requirements and resolve design questions.
- Create SOPs and systems in collaboration with Office Manager.
- Client
Experience:- Serve as the primary design contact during the selections phase.
- Keep clients informed of timelines, approvals, and next steps.
- Balance client preferences with construction realities.
- Create and manage client’s End-of-Project Manual.
